Объект приемника файлов модуля записи
[Функция, связанная с этой страницей, Windows Media Format 11 SDK, является устаревшей функцией. Он был заменен средством чтения исходного кода и модуля записи приемника. Средство чтения исходного кода и модуль записи приемника оптимизированы для Windows 10 и Windows 11. Корпорация Майкрософт настоятельно рекомендует, чтобы новый код по возможности использовал средство чтения исходного кода и модуль записи приемника вместо пакета SDK для Windows Media Format 11. Корпорация Майкрософт предлагает переписать существующий код, в котором используются устаревшие API, чтобы по возможности использовать новые API.]
Объект приемника файла записи используется при записи выходных данных Windows Media в файл.
Объект приемника файла записи создается функцией WMCreateWriterFileSink, которая задает указатель на интерфейс IWMWriterFileSink . Другие интерфейсы объекта приемника файла записи можно получить, вызвав метод QueryInterface .
Следующие интерфейсы поддерживаются объектом приемника файлов записи.
Интерфейс | Описание |
---|---|
IWMRegisterCallback | Позволяет приложению получать сообщения о состоянии из объекта . |
IWMWriterFileSink | Открывает файл, в который объект записи может записывать данные. |
IWMWriterFileSink2 | Обеспечивает расширенное управление объектом приемника файлов. Наследует все методы IWMWriterFileSink. |
IWMWriterFileSink3 | Предоставляет дополнительные параметры для записи файлов. Наследует все методы IWMWriterFileSink и IWMWriterFileSink2. |
IWMWriterSink | Выделяет память, определяет, работает ли приемник в режиме реального времени, и обрабатывает несколько функций обратного вызова. |
Следующий интерфейс обратного вызова должен быть реализован приложением для отслеживания хода выполнения объекта приемника файла записи.
Интерфейс | Описание |
---|---|
IWMStatusCallback | Требуется, когда сведения о состоянии должны передаваться в ведущее приложение. |
Связанные темы